
The LMV824IDR is a general purpose BICMOS operational amplifier with a gain bandwidth product of 5.5MHz. It operates over a temperature range of -40°C to 125°C and is available in a SOIC-14 package. The device has a low input bias current of 40nA and an input offset voltage of 1mV. It can supply up to 45mA of output current per channel and has a slew rate of 1.9V/µs. The LMV824IDR is RoHS compliant and is packaged on a tape and reel.
